Abstract

A Bluetooth wireless earphone set. In order to provide a communication equipment component which can bidirectionally adjust the angle, has the functions of exchanging left and right ears and can adjust the fitting degree, the utility model is provided, which comprises an earphone body, an ear hook and a bidirectional pivoting mechanism for bidirectionally pivoting the ear hook on the earphone body; the earphone body is formed by oppositely arranging a shell and a bottom shell, and a shaft hole is formed at one end of the bottom shell; the bidirectional pivoting mechanism comprises a base and a circular shaft body which is formed on the base and penetrates through the shaft hole of the bottom shell from inside to outside, and a pivoting hole which radially penetrates through the circular shaft body and is used for the ear hook to be pivoted is formed in the circular shaft body; the body part of the ear hook is arc-shaped for a user to hang on the ear, and one end of the body part forms a pivot part; the pivot part is correspondingly pivoted in the pivot hole on the circular shaft body of the bidirectional pivoting mechanism so as to form first and second direction pivoting along the axis of the corresponding circular shaft body and the axis of the pivot hole on the circular shaft body.

具体实施方式Detailed ways

如图1所示,本实用新型包含耳机本体10、枢设于耳机本体10上的耳挂20及双向枢接机构30。As shown in FIG. 1 , the present invention includes an earphone body 10 , an earhook 20 pivotally mounted on the earphone body 10 , and a two-way pivot mechanism 30 .

耳挂20可双向枢转地枢设于耳机本体10上。The ear hook 20 is pivotally mounted on the earphone body 10 so as to be pivotable in both directions.

耳机本体10由表壳11及底壳12相对组成,其内部具有适当可供容置电路板14、天线等相关元件的空间。底壳12于一端形成借以供双向枢接机构30由内向外枢穿的贯穿轴孔13。The earphone body 10 is composed of a watch case 11 and a bottom case 12 facing each other, and there is suitable space for accommodating related components such as a circuit board 14 and an antenna inside the earphone body 10 . A shaft hole 13 is formed at one end of the bottom shell 12 for the two-way pivot mechanism 30 to pivot from inside to outside.

双向枢接机构30包含底座31及形成于底座31上的圆轴体32。The two-way pivot mechanism 30 includes a base 31 and a circular shaft 32 formed on the base 31 .

如图2所示,底座31呈圆盘状,其周缘的适当位置分别形成第一缺口311及第二缺口312。As shown in FIG. 2 , the base 31 is disc-shaped, and a first notch 311 and a second notch 312 are respectively formed at appropriate positions around the base.

圆轴体32上形成径向贯穿以供耳挂20枢设的枢孔33,枢孔33孔壁上形成数个对称排列且可弹性收缩的弧凸部330,弧凸部330与底座31上的第一/第二缺口311/312均作为定位用。A pivot hole 33 is formed on the circular axis body 32 to penetrate radially for the pivoting of the earhook 20 . Several symmetrically arranged and elastically shrinkable arc protrusions 330 are formed on the wall of the pivot hole 33 . The first/second gaps 311/312 are used for positioning.

耳挂20的本体部分呈弧形状,供使用者配挂于耳上,其一端形成枢轴部21,借以对应枢设于双向枢接机构30圆轴体32上的枢孔33内。枢轴部21于等称的径面上形成有数个凹弧切面210,凹弧切面210分别与圆轴杆32的枢孔33孔壁上的弧凸部330对应于并相互配合。The body part of the ear hook 20 is arc-shaped for the user to hang on the ear. One end of the ear hook 20 forms a pivot portion 21 so as to be correspondingly pivoted in the pivot hole 33 on the circular shaft body 32 of the two-way pivot mechanism 30 . The pivot portion 21 is formed with several concave arc cut surfaces 210 on the equivalent radial surface, and the concave arc cut surfaces 210 respectively correspond to and cooperate with the arc convex portions 330 on the wall of the pivot hole 33 of the circular shaft rod 32 .

如图2所示,耳机本体10于底壳12内侧面上设有挡40,挡板40一端固定于底壳12的内侧面上,使挡板40适位于双向枢接机构30的下方,并对其构成支撑;挡板40一另端形成有两道平行于长边的缺槽41,并在两缺槽41间形成可上下伸缩的挡块42。挡块42自由端上形成有向上突出的凸部420,凸部420分别对应于双向枢接机构30底座31上的第一/第二缺口311/312。As shown in FIG. 2 , the earphone body 10 is provided with a baffle 40 on the inner side of the bottom case 12 , and one end of the baffle 40 is fixed on the inner side of the bottom case 12 , so that the baffle 40 is positioned below the two-way pivot mechanism 30 , and To support it; the other end of the baffle plate 40 is formed with two slots 41 parallel to the long sides, and between the two slots 41 is formed a stopper 42 that can be stretched up and down. The free end of the block 42 is formed with an upward protruding protrusion 420 , and the protrusion 420 respectively corresponds to the first/second notch 311 / 312 on the base 31 of the two-way pivot mechanism 30 .

底壳12的轴孔13外侧孔缘上卡合设有转轴盖50。如图3、图4所示,转轴盖50上形成对应于双向枢接机构30上的枢孔33的径向贯穿通孔51,通孔51供耳挂20一端的枢轴部21通过而枢设于双向枢接机构30上枢孔33内。A shaft cover 50 is fitted on the outer edge of the shaft hole 13 of the bottom case 12 . As shown in Fig. 3 and Fig. 4, a radial through hole 51 corresponding to the pivot hole 33 on the two-way pivot mechanism 30 is formed on the shaft cover 50, and the through hole 51 is for the pivot part 21 at one end of the ear hook 20 to pass through and pivot. It is arranged in the upper pivot hole 33 of the two-way pivot mechanism 30 .

使用时,借由枢设于耳机本体10上的双向枢接机构30提供耳挂20双向枢转的功能。如图5所示,其第一方向为供耳挂20沿双向枢接机构30圆轴体32的轴心方向枢转;其第二方向则为供耳挂20沿双向枢接机构30圆轴体32上径向枢孔33的轴心方向枢转。其中,耳挂20在第一方向枢转时可作为左右耳切换,在第二方向上枢转时,则调整耳机本体10贴靠耳际的松紧度,令使用者可舒适地配戴耳机组。In use, the bidirectional pivoting function of the earhook 20 is provided by the bidirectional pivoting mechanism 30 pivotally arranged on the earphone body 10 . As shown in FIG. 5 , the first direction is for the earhook 20 to pivot along the axial direction of the circular axis body 32 of the two-way pivot mechanism 30 ; The body 32 pivots in the axial direction of the radial pivot hole 33 . Wherein, when the earhook 20 pivots in the first direction, it can be used as a left and right ear switch, and when it pivots in the second direction, the tightness of the earphone body 10 against the ear can be adjusted, so that the user can wear the earphone set comfortably .

本实用新型除具双向枢转角度调整功能外,其亦提供定位功能:当双向枢接机构30随耳挂20在第一方向上枢转时,其枢转时至特定角度时,挡板40上的挡块42将以其凸部420进入双向枢接机构30底座31上的第一缺口311或第二缺口312,借以使耳挂20定位在第一方向上调整后的位置。In addition to the two-way pivot angle adjustment function, the utility model also provides a positioning function: when the two-way pivot mechanism 30 pivots in the first direction with the earhook 20, when it pivots to a specific angle, the baffle 40 The stopper 42 on the top will enter the first notch 311 or the second notch 312 on the base 31 of the two-way pivot mechanism 30 with its protrusion 420 , so that the earhook 20 is positioned at the adjusted position in the first direction.

又因耳挂20及双向枢接机构30均由具适当弹性的材料,如塑胶制成,当耳挂20的枢轴部21以第二方向在双向枢接机构30的径向枢孔33内枢转时,其径面将受枢孔33孔壁的弧凸部330压挤,俟通过后,弧凸部330即对应抵掣于枢轴部21上的凹弧切面210上,在此状况下,枢轴部21除非再受力旋转,否则将维持在此状态下,借此,使耳挂20定位在第二方向上调整后的位置。And because the earhook 20 and the two-way pivot mechanism 30 are both made of suitable elastic materials, such as plastic, when the pivot portion 21 of the earhook 20 is in the radial pivot hole 33 of the two-way pivot mechanism 30 in the second direction, When pivoting, its radial surface will be squeezed by the arc convex portion 330 on the wall of the pivot hole 33. After passing through, the arc convex portion 330 will be correspondingly locked on the concave arc section 210 on the pivot portion 21. In this situation Next, unless the pivot portion 21 is forced to rotate again, it will remain in this state, whereby the earhook 20 is positioned at the adjusted position in the second direction.

综上所述,本实用新型的无线耳机组利用双向枢接机构可使耳挂分别以两种不同方向调整其角度,而分别产生左右耳切换及贴合松紧度的调节的功效,除此以外,在完成角度调整后并赋予定位功能,使耳挂得以定位在调整后的角度/位置上。To sum up, the wireless earphone set of the present invention can use the two-way pivoting mechanism to adjust the angle of the earhook in two different directions, so as to produce the effects of switching between the left and right ears and adjusting the tightness of the fit. , after completing the angle adjustment and endowing it with a positioning function, so that the earhook can be positioned at the adjusted angle/position.
